RJI Updated
3 Years old and cleans up well. Aftermarket grill insert, Pinstripe and 4 coats of Ceramic polish. Bought it with 32000 miles and less than 3 years old. Had Sync 3 problems and after 4 trips to the dealer it was corrected with new GPS module. Also a few other minor warranty items that the dealer took care of.
Replaced the Michelin Latitude tires at 1/2 tread. They howled so bad I thought I had a bad bearing. Replaced with Goodyear Comfort Drive. Extremely quiet, great ride and handles wet roads very well.
I replaced the gray grill with a Black aftermarket overlay. It fit perfect and seems like very high quality. Just my choice for color.
I added pinstripe at the body line to off set the flat sides
Finally I clay barred the car and gave it 4 coats of ceramic polish. It improved the depth look of the pain. Time will tell on how long it last.
This is my first Ford in a long time and now that the bugs are worked out, I am very happy with it. I have tried the things like park assist, advance cruise, rain sensitive wipers, lane correction and more, and they work as advertised, but I have turned some off.
Gas mileage is not what I think it should be at 18 city and around 25 city. But I do like the power and smoothness. of the 2.0 turbo.
I think the stop start with its disconnect switch is a nice feature , except it rarely works. Dealer says that is normal, but I have driven many with it and they work fine.
Comfort gets high marks except for the front seat back which has a pillow effect near the top and having a bad disc, it aggravates my back. Right now I an trying different pads to cushion my back.
